Centurion: Control Engineer

Advertisement



Job Description

We are a leading provider of energy-efficient, innovative equipment, instrumentation, and process control systems to the global mining industry. With companies in Brazil, Chile, Mexico and South Africa, we have built a reputation based on quality, performance and safety. The company is entrepreneurial, dynamic and our team is driven to succeed. We are looking for like-minded individuals that want to be part of a transformational business. Role Summary: This position is a new opportunity in our company. This role is for a position within the APC department, which works with mine sites around the world (both remotely and on site), to deploy and integrate optimization solutions for the benefit of clients and industry. This role is ideal for someone who enjoys travelling and has an analytical mind. Essential Responsibilities: Development, deployment, and integration of advanced regulatory control applications. Support the deployment and integration of expert systems. Analyze and troubleshoot control system issues and provide solutions to improve system performance and reliability. Experience with commissioning and tuning of control systems. Produce technical documentation (e.g., reports, manuals, and specifications, drawings). Conduct data analyses. Verification and validation of software through inspection, simulation, and testing. Work with cross-functional teams to develop and implement control systems for new projects. Perform regular reviews and upgrades on existing control systems to ensure optimal performance. Ensure compliance with safety regulations and industry standards. Qualifications/Requirements: A post-secondary Diploma or Degree in Electrical, Instrumentation, or Process Automation Engineering. 3 years of post-graduate experience in a control engineering project environment. Proficiency in developing software (Logic and SCADA) for control systems (ABB, DeltaV, Siemens, Rockwell, Schneider, Honeywell, etc.) Recommended to have experience with multiple control systems, including PLCs, SCADA systems, and DCS systems (ABB, DeltaV, Siemens, Rockwell, Schneider, Honeywell, etc.) Strong problem-solving skills and ability to troubleshoot control systems. Experience with programming languages, such as Ladder Logic, Function Block Diagram, and Structured Text. Strong written, communication and interpersonal skills. Familiarity with industry standards and regulations related to control systems.

About Engineering Jobs in Tshwane

Tshwane, the administrative capital of South Africa, is home to a thriving engineering sector that encompasses various industries such as financial services, technology, and manufacturing. Generally, the job market for engineers in Tshwane tends to be competitive, with a high demand for skilled professionals. Typically, engineers in this region can expect to find stable employment opportunities, albeit with varying degrees of seniority and compensation.

When it comes to salary expectations, engineers in Tshwane can generally expect to earn between R800 000 and R1 500 000 per annum, depending on factors such as level of experience, company size, industry sector, and specific job requirements. However, it is essential to note that these figures are broad estimates and may vary significantly depending on individual circumstances.

Common skills required for engineering positions in Tshwane include proficiency in computer-aided design (CAD), programming languages such as Python or C++, and strong analytical and problem-solving skills. Typically, engineers in this region also possess a degree in a relevant field such as mechanical, electrical, or civil engineering, and may hold professional certifications like the Professional Engineer (PE) designation. Other commonly required skills include project management, communication, and teamwork.

Engineering roles are often found across various industry sectors, including financial services, technology, manufacturing, and infrastructure development. The technology industry, in particular, is a significant employer of engineers, with companies like Google and Microsoft often having a presence in Tshwane. Other common industries that employ engineers include the automotive sector, which is well-represented in the city due to its proximity to major manufacturers.
